JebusMail
Easily mail friends, guild members, alts and others.
Features:
- Remembers last recipient and fills it in each time
- Adds a drop-down menu to the recipient box. This drops down 4 categories: Alts, Friends, Guild, Other
- Log in as each alt to get it listed in the Alts list
- Delivery notification (sound optional) for items sent to non-alts
- Right-click on a message in the summary window to collect items and money (one at a time)
- Displays total money received once the mailbox window is closed
- Options are found in the new 2.4 Interface Options - AddOns window
[2009/10/26 17:49:11-6548-x1]: JebusMail-3.20a\JebusMail.lua:19: AceAddon: AceOO-2.0: Library "AceComm-2.0" does not exist.
FuBar2Broker-r86-release\libs\AceLibrary\AceLibrary.lua:122: in function <...e\AddOns\FuBar2Broker\libs\AceLibrary\AceLibrary.lua:75>
(tail call): ?:
(tail call): ?:
AceAddon-2.0-91096 (AutoBar):1030: in function `new'
JebusMail-3.20a\JebusMail.lua:19: in main chunk
Locals:
self =
UnregisterAllEvents =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:528:
addonsStarted =
CancelScheduledE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:464:
InitializeAddon =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:562:
instancemeta =
CancelAllScheduledEvents =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:574:
ScheduleE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:440:
TriggerE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:233:
addons =
prototype =
GetLocalizedCategory =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:505:
ManualDisable =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:1062:
ScheduleLeaveCombatAction =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:802:
CancelAllCombatSchedules =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:753:
UnregisterAllBucketEvents =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:740:
ADDON_LOADED =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:518:
PLAYER_LOGIN =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:976:
GetAceOptionsDataTable =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:954:
slashCommand = "/ace2"
ScheduleRepeatingE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:452:
super =
ManualEnable =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:1034:
addonsToOnEnable =
(null) = true
pcall = <function> @ FuBar2Broker\libs\AceLibrary\AceLibrary.lua:167:
new =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:1029:
GetLibraryVersion = <function> @ FuBar2Broker\libs\AceLibrary\AceLibrary.lua:585:
nextAddon =
UnregisterE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:493:
skipAddon =
RegisterE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:98:
IsEventRegistered =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:590:
IsEventScheduled =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:482:
ToString = <function> @ A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:510:
RegisterBucketE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:607:
uid = "1C989178"
IsBucketEventRegistered =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:711:
addonsEnabled =
argCheck = <function> @ FuBar2Broker\libs\AceLibrary\AceLibrary.lua:129:
UnregisterBucketEvent =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:716:
error = <function> @ FuBar2Broker\libs\AceLibrary\AceLibrary.lua:75:
RegisterAllEvents = <function> @ AutoBar\libs\AceEvent-2.0\AceEvent-2.0.lua:200:
}
message = "AceAddon: AceOO-2.0: Library "AceComm-2.0" does not exist."
stack = "...e\AddOns\FuBar2Broker\libs\AceLibrary\AceLibrary.lua:80: in function <...e\AddOns\FuBar2Broker\libs\AceLibrary\AceLibrary.lua:75>
(tail call): ?
(tail call): ?
...ce\AddOns\AutoBar\libs\AceAddon-2.0\AceAddon-2.0.lua:1030: in function `new'
JebusMail\JebusMail.lua:19: in main chunk
"
first = "...e\AddOns\FuBar2Broker\libs\AceLibrary\AceLibrary.lua:80: in function <...e\AddOns\FuBar2Broker\libs\AceLibrary\AceLibrary.lua:75>"
file = "AceAddon%-2%.0"
i = 3
j = 4
(for generator) = <function> defined =[C]:-1
(for state) = nil
(for control) = "Interface
---
ID: 1
Error occured in: Global
Count: 1
Message: ..\AddOns\Postal\Modules\BlackBook.lua line 151:
attempt to index local 'editbox' (a nil value)
Debug:
[C]: ?
Postal\Modules\BlackBook.lua:151: ?()
...erface\AddOns\Titan\libs\AceHook-3.0\AceHook-3.0.lua:87: OnEditFocusGained()
JebusMail\JebusMail.lua:692:
JebusMail\JebusMail.lua:685
(tail call): ?
[C]: SetFocus()
[string "*:OnShow"]:8:
[string "*:OnShow"]:1
[C]: Show()
..\FrameXML\MailFrame.lua:99: MailFrameTab_OnClick()
Postal\Modules\BlackBook.lua:140:
Postal\Modules\BlackBook.lua:139
(tail call): ?
[string "*:OnClick"]:1:
[string "*:OnClick"]:1
AddOns:
Swatter, v5.6.4424 (KangaII)
Corpse, v3.2.0.1
Ace2, v
barnett444: You have to delete the JebusMail.lua file in the SavedVariables directory and update to the latest version.
The delivery notice for alts bug was a side-effect of the name duplication bug, and should go away as well.
What about the delivery notice for alts bug?
I believe I fixed a name duplication bug that was introduced in v3.03f. If you had the exclusion setting set to "Nothing" then you will need to delete the JebusMail.lua file in your WTF/Account/AccountName/SavedVariables directory. Sorry 'bout that.
Its annoying, I'm going back to 3.0.3e.
Loot all button please. Only reason i'd want a mail addon. TY!
It seems that with each logon a new entry for this char is created. And it would be fine if the "delivery notification time" for alts can be fixed.
Featurerequest : Possibility to get all AH-Returns at once. Perhaps with a Button.
Thank you.
Issues with v3.03f:
- getting 1 hour delivery notices for my alts (JM should know that mailing your alts is instant)
- seeing character names repeated multiple times in a row in the various dropdowns for selecting sender name
- getting 1 hour delivery notices for my alts (JM should know that mailing your alts is instant)
- seeing character names repeated multiple times in a row in the various dropdowns for selecting sender name
For some reason, if I try to run this in conjunction with BetterInbox, I often won't be able to see my mail if I have only 1 or 2 items in my inbox.
I wish mail addons were more modular so that I could more easily make them play nice with each other. It seems like each mail addon only does part of what I want, yet they all seem to step on each other :(